**About the role**

As a Children's Residential Worker, you will be a positive role model for the children within Amegreen Children’s Services, offering care and support to children with Learning Disabilities providing structure, consistency, and nurturing as part of day-to-day living, always ensuring the safety of each child. You will build effective relationships with the children, support them with routine (personal care may be required), join the children in activities and holidays, creating meaningful care plans, working together with parents, teachers, therapists, and social workers, write reports and ensuring records are kept clear and up to date. These are just some examples of the work you will do that will support our children and young people with their everyday lives.

There will be great days where you will laugh, play games and bring joy to the children but there will be times where the children may shout, swear and cry, but by listening to them, guiding, and offering comfort during challenging times through your kindness, you will find this role really rewarding and see more of those great days

**About Us**

Amegreen Children’s Services is an established and respected provider of residential children’s homes having been established in 2013. Our independent children’s homes are rated as Outstanding by Ofsted and provide therapeutic care to children between the ages of 5 and 18 who are unable to live with their families.
